Effective Methods for Sanitizing Glass Bottles and Lids
Properly sanitizing glass bottles and their lids is essential for safe reuse, especially when storing food, beverages, or other sensitive products. Whether you're preserving homemade jams, storing herbs, or repurposing containers for craft projects, knowing how to sanitize glass bottles thoroughly prevents contamination and extends the life of your containers.
The Importance of Sanitizing Glass Bottles and Lids
Sanitizing differs from regular cleaning. While cleaning removes visible dirt and residue, sanitizing reduces microorganisms to safe levels. For glass bottles and jars, proper sanitization is crucial because microscopic contaminants can harbor bacteria, mold, and other pathogens that may cause spoilage or illness.

Heat Sanitization Methods
Heat is one of the most effective ways to sanitize glass bottles and jars. There are several approaches, each with specific benefits.
The Boiling Method
Boiling is a traditional and highly effective method for sanitizing glass containers:
- Fill a large pot with water
- Submerge clean glass bottles completely
- Bring water to a rolling boil
- Maintain the boil for 10-15 minutes
- Remove bottles carefully using tongs
- Allow to air dry on a clean towel
A common question is how long to boil bottles to sanitize them properly. While 10 minutes is generally sufficient for most applications, extending to 15 minutes provides an extra margin of safety for canning and food preservation. The water must maintain a rolling boil throughout the process to ensure proper sanitization.
The Oven Method
For completely dry sanitization, the oven method works well:
- Preheat oven to 225 °F (107 °C)
- Place clean, dry bottles on a baking sheet
- Heat for 20 minutes
- Turn off the oven and allow bottles to cool inside
This method is particularly useful when sanitizing glass bottles for dry storage purposes. The dry heat effectively eliminates microorganisms without the need for drying afterward.
Caution: Never place cold glass directly in a hot oven or hot glass directly under cold water, as thermal shock can cause breakage.
Chemical Sanitization Methods
When heat methods aren't practical, chemical sanitizers offer effective alternatives for how to disinfect a glass bottle.
Bleach Solution
A diluted bleach solution is highly effective for sanitizing glass:
- Mix 1 tablespoon of unscented bleach per gallon of water
- Submerge bottles completely for 5 minutes
- Rinse thoroughly with clean water
- Allow to air dry completely
This method is recommended by many food preservation experts for canning jars when boiling isn't possible.
Vinegar Method
For those preferring natural options:
- Fill bottles with equal parts white vinegar and hot water
- Let sit for 10 minutes
- Rinse thoroughly with clean water
- Allow to air dry
While not as powerful as bleach, vinegar's acidity effectively reduces many common bacteria and is food-safe without rinsing.
Alcohol-Based Sanitizers
Alcohol solutions (70% isopropyl or ethyl alcohol) can be used for quick sanitization:
- Spray or wipe the interior and exterior surfaces
- Ensure all surfaces remain wet for at least 30 seconds
- Allow to air dry completely

How to Sanitize Bottle Lids and Caps
Lids and caps require special attention since they often have rubber seals or plastic components that may not withstand high heat. When considering how do you sanitize mason jars lids, follow these guidelines:
- For metal lids with rubber seals: Simmer (not boil) in water at 180 °F (82 °C) for 10 minutes
- For plastic caps: Use chemical sanitization methods
- For cork stoppers: Soak in a solution of 1 part hydrogen peroxide to 3 parts water for 5 minutes, then rinse and dry

Best Practices for Long-Term Glass Container Maintenance
Maintaining properly sanitized glass containers involves more than just the initial cleaning process:
- Always clean bottles thoroughly before sanitizing to remove all residue
- Inspect glass for chips or cracks before reuse
- Store sanitized bottles upside down to prevent dust accumulation
- Re-sanitize bottles that have been stored for extended periods
- Consider the manufacturing process and glass quality when determining sanitization methods
For bottles with stubborn residue or odors, a paste of baking soda and water can be used as a pre-treatment before sanitizing. This is particularly helpful for removing persistent smells or stains.
